The Administrative Assistant, a key member of the Group Benefits Underwriting team, is responsible for managing the underwriting mailbox, including monitoring incoming messages, distributing work, and retrieving all enrollment forms and related documentation. This role also involves converting enrollment emails and attachments into PDFs for processing and performing all indexing activities required to support the Underwriting team.

The duties will include:

  • Monitor the underwriting mailbox and ensure incoming enrollment forms are converted and sent to an indexing queue
  • Distribute emails from the underwriting mailbox to appropriate team members/departments
  • Convert enrollment form emails and attachments into a single PDF and upload to the indexing queue
  • Monitor the indexing queue and index all documents based on written procedures
  • Build and maintain relationships with internal partners to improve department performance

As an Administrative Assistant, you'll provide a broad range of administrative support functions, under direct supervision. You will compose internal correspondence, maintain and update office records, gather information for reports and presentations and coordinate calendars for leader(s) and/or team.

Job Description

Key Responsibilities: 

  • Focuses on the daily calendar planning. Usually does not manage leader's personal calendar. 

  • Coordinates and provides options for travel plans for leader(s) and team.

  • Screens communications for action items and due dates, bringing key items to the leader's attention. Initiates necessary actions, e.g., follow-ups, prioritizations, action required, etc. 

  • Provides assistance with office procedures or processes that help the team be more productive and efficient. 

  • Monitors expenses, processes expense reports in a timely manner and monitors expense reports submitted by staff for accurate reporting. 

  • Performs quality check of invoices/accounts payable. Inputs travel expense and other expenses for payment; reviews and passes to office budget coordinator.

  • Helps other administrative assistants as needed. May provide general office training to new associates.

  • Stays current on Nationwide procedure changes, Human Resources policy changes, business environment, etc. that impact department-level plans.

  • Participates in special projects as assigned.
